Sir William Van Horne
Dynamic and imaginative, as General Manager, Vice President, and then President of the Canadian Pacifice Railway during its formative years, he contributed much to its success and to the development of this country. Born in Chelsea, Illinois, 3rd February, 1843. Died in Montréal, 11th September, 1915.
